Growth, yield and quality of China aster varieties as influenced by pinching

Abstract

An investigation on “Growth, yield and quality of China aster varieties influenced by pinching” was carried out at College of Agriculture, Nagpur during 2017-18 to study the response of China aster varieties to various pinching treatments in factorial randomised block design with 12 treatment combinations comprising of four varieties of China aster as main factor viz., V1 – Arka Kamini, V2 –Arka Archana, V3 - Arka Shashank and V4 - Arka Adhya and three pinching methods as sub factor viz., P1 – No pinching, P2 –Single pinching and P3 –Double pinching replicated thrice. Single pinching was carried out on 30th day and double pinching on 30th and 45th day after transplanting. The results revealed that, significantly maximum plant spread and the earliest commencement of flowering and 50 per cent flowering were recorded with the variety Arka Archana, whereas, stem diameter was noted maximum with Arka Adhya. However, flower yield plant-1, weight of flower and blooming period were recorded highest with the variety Arka Kamini. In respect of pinching methods, plant spread, stem diameter, flower yield plant-1 and blooming period were noticed significantly maximum with double pinching, whereas, diameter and weight of flower were noted maximum and days for commencement of flowering and 50 per cent flowering were minimum with no pinching treatment. An interaction effect was found non-significant with respect to all the parameters.
